         >> Kotys II (about 123 / 124 – 133 A.D.).

Denomination: Sestertius
Year: -
Material: Copper
Description: 129 - 130 A.D.
Obverse: BACIΛEΩC KOTYOC, bust of King Cotys II wearing garter right, beaded circle.
Reverse: Shield, spear pointing upwards behind, horse's head to left, axe beneath it, head left with helmet on is to right, sword in sheath below. M is to left of spear, H to right.
Diameter - 25 mm. Weight - 7.89 g.
Country or town: Pantikapaion
